Human Resources Generalist

Department: Geophysics
Location: MISSISSAUGA, ON

Human Resource Generalist

SUMMARY:

The position is responsible for divisional recruitment, benefit administration; compensation; employee relations; compliance with federal, state and local employment law and regulations; payroll processing and labor reporting, training; and other related functions. Develops, plans and implements policies relating to all phases of human resources activity by performing the following duties personally or through management staff and in coordination with overall corporate policies and initiatives.

KEY RESPONSIBILITIES:

  • Plan, develop, implement, and evaluate HR policies, procedures, and programs to support organizational objectives
  • Provide guidance to managers and employees on HR policies, employment standards, benefits, and workplace practices
  • Administer employee relations matters, including staff consultations, conflict resolution, and grievance procedures
  • Support full-cycle recruitment including job postings, screening, interviewing, hiring, and onboarding
  • Coordinate and administer employee performance management processes, including performance reviews and coaching support
  • Manage employee training and development initiatives to enhance workforce capability
  • Oversee payroll coordination and administration of employee benefits and employment equity programs
  • Ensure compliance with employment legislation, labour standards, health and safety regulations, and internal policies
  • Maintain and analyze employee data and HR metrics to support workforce planning and reporting
  • Respond to employee inquiries and workplace concerns in a timely and professional manner
  • Assist in developing internal HR communication strategies and preparing management reports
  • Participate in HR projects related to compensation, employee engagement, and organizational development
  • Recommend and implement improvements to HR systems, processes, and procedures
  • Other duties as assigned

EDUCATION:

  • Bachelor’s degree (minimum) in Human Resources Management, Business Administration, Industrial Relations, or related discipline.
  • Master’s or Doctoral degree in Human Resources, Management, or Organizational Development (strongly preferred).

EXPERIENCE:

  • 5+ years of progressive HR experience with end-to-end expertise across recruitment, onboarding, employee relations, performance management, training and development, and HR policy development to support business growth and operational excellence.
  • Strong working knowledge of Ontario employment legislation and compliance requirements, including employment standards, human rights, and occupational health and safety regulations, ensuring risk mitigation and organizational compliance.
  • Proven experience leveraging HRIS, payroll platforms, and workforce analytics to streamline HR operations, improve reporting accuracy, and support informed business decision-making.
  • Demonstrated ability to manage sensitive and complex employee relations matters, including investigations, disciplinary actions, terminations, and conflict resolution, with a practical, business-focused approach.
  • Strong background in payroll administration, benefits coordination, statutory deductions, and regulatory reporting to ensure accuracy, timeliness, and cost control.
  • Highly developed communication and interpersonal skills, enabling productive relationships with employees, leaders, vendors, and external partners.
  • Proven ability to lead interviews, facilitate management meetings, and deliver practical, business-oriented training and presentations.
  • Recognized professional credentials, including CHRP, SHRM-CP, or equivalent qualifications, demonstrating commitment to continuous professional development and best practices.

CERTIFICATES, LICENSES, REGISTRATIONS

CHRP or CHRL certification is desirable.

Salary Range: $41.50 CAD per hour

Sanborn offers a comprehensive health and wellness program which includes medical, dental, vision, 401k, holiday, PTO, EAP, disability and life insurance benefits.
